The Earth Sciences in the Enlightenment: Studies on the Early Development of Geology (Variorum Collected Studies)
by Kenneth L. TaylorThis volume is concerned with the geological sciences in the 18th century, with special emphasis on France and French scientists. A first focus is on the pioneering geologist Nicolas Desmarest, whose investigations in Auvergne and Italy (among other places) had important consequences in geological theory and practice. Desmarest emerges as a figure of intriguing complexity and refined methodological convictions, defying facile interpretation in terms of, for instance, a simple polarity between vulcanism and neptunism. Widening his inquiry beyond Desmarest, Professor Taylor also endeavors to recover key elements of the presuppositions and thought-patterns of Enlightenment geologists, and to discern how geological investigation worked during this formative period. In the era that modern geological science was beginning to take form, many of the participants are seen as struggling to define their scientific objectives and procedures by drawing from the competing frameworks of physique or natural philosophy, descriptive natural history, and antiquarian scholarship or developmental history. One of the articles (Reflections on Natural Laws in Eighteenth-Century Geology) appears here for the first time in English.

Earth-Shattering Events: Earthquakes, Nations, and Civilization
by Andrew Robinson"A truly welcome and refreshing study that puts earthquake impact on history into a proper perspective." --Amos Nur, Emeritus Professor of Geophysics, Stanford University, California, and author of Apocalypse: Earthquakes, Archaeology, and the Wrath of God Since antiquity, on every continent, human beings in search of attractive landscapes and economic prosperity have made a Faustian bargain with the risk of devastation by an earthquake. Today, around half of the world’s largest cities – as many as sixty – lie in areas of major seismic activity. Many, such as Lisbon, Naples, San Francisco, Teheran, and Tokyo, have been severely damaged or destroyed by earthquakes in the past. But throughout history, starting with ancient Jericho, Rome, and Sparta, cities have proved to be extraordinarily resilient: only one, Port Royal in the Caribbean, was abandoned after an earthquake. Earth-Shattering Events seeks to understand exactly how humans and earthquakes have interacted, not only in the short term but also in the long perspective of history. In some cases, physical devastation has been followed by decline. But in others, the political and economic reverberations of earthquake disasters have presented opportunities for renewal. After its wholesale destruction in 1906, San Francisco went on to flourish, eventually giving birth to the high-tech industrial area on the San Andreas fault known as Silicon Valley. An earthquake in Caracas in 1812 triggered the creation of new nations in the liberation of South America from Spanish rule. Another in Tangshan in 1976 catalysed the transformation of China into the world’s second largest economy. The growth of the scientific study of earthquakes is woven into this far-reaching history. It began with a series of earthquakes in England in 1750. Today, seismologists can monitor the vibration of the planet second by second and the movement of tectonic plates millimeter by millimeter. Yet, even in the 21st century, great earthquakes are still essentially "acts of God," striking with much less warning than volcanoes, floods, hurricanes, and even tornadoes and tsunamis.
Earth-Sheltered Houses
by Rob RoyAn earth-sheltered, earth-roofed home has the least impact upon the land of all housing styles, leaving almost zero footprint on the planet. Earth-Sheltered Houses is a practical guide for those who want to build their own underground home at moderate cost. It describes the benefits of sheltering a home with earth, including the added comfort and energy efficiency from the moderating influence of the earth on the home's temperature (keeping it warm in the winter and cool in the summer), along with the benefits of low maintenance and the protection against fire, sound, earthquake, and storm afforded by the earth. Extra benefits from adding an earth or other living roof option include greater longevity of the roof substrate, fine aesthetics, and environmental harmony.The book covers all of the various construction techniques involved, including details on planning, excavation, footings, floor, walls, framing, roofing, waterproofing, insulation, and drainage. Specific methods appropriate for the inexperienced owner/builder are a particular focus and include: Pouring one's own footings and/or floor The use of dry-stacked (surface-bonded) concrete block walls Post-and-beam framing Plank-and-beam roofing Drainage methods and self-adhesive waterproofing membranes The time-tested, easy-to-learn construction techniques described in Earth-Sheltered Houses will enable readers to embark upon their own building projects with confidence, backed up by a comprehensive resources section that lists all the latest products such as waterproofing membranes, types of rigid insulation, and drainage products that will protect the building against water damage and heat loss. Earth Surface Processes and Environmental Changes in East Asia
by Kenji Kashiwaya Ji Shen Ju Yong KimThis book examines relationships between climate-hydrological changes and other phenomena including land use and natural disasters during the Holocene and recent past. In particular, periods of rapid climatic shifts such as global warming and global cooling are examined through paleohydrological and other studies of various lake-catchment systems in East Asia, from Mongolia in the north to Taiwan in the south. A number of different research techniques are used in the work presented here, including sediment analysis and optically stimulated luminescence dating and the reader learns how the lake-catchment system functions as a "proxy observatory" for past and present environmental monitoring. The lake catchments studied by the authors of this volume are under similar climatic conditions, i. e. , under the East Asia monsoon, with some systematic difference in climatic factors. Both proxy and observation data are available for the surrounding countries' provisions against natural disasters that are related to climate-hydrological events and readers will see how present instrumental observation data can be connected to past proxy data (sediment information) in the system.

Earth System Modelling - Volume 5
by Graham Riley Reinhard Budich Rupert Ford René RedlerCollected articles in this series are dedicated to the development and use of software for earth system modelling and aims at bridging the gap between IT solutions and climate science. The particular topic covered in this volume addresses the process of configuring, building, and running earth system models. Earth system models are typically a collection of interacting computer codes (often called components) which together simulate the earth system. Each code component is written to model some physical process which forms part of the earth system (such as the Ocean). This book is concerned with the source code version control of these code components, the configuration of these components into earth system models, the creation of executable(s) from the component source code and related libraries and the running and monitoring of the resultant executables on the available hardware.
